SEND Teacher
An inclusive and welcoming Specialist SEND primary school in SM4 is seeking a KS2 Teacher to join their team on a full-time basis from September 2026. This is a fantastic opportunity to lead a small specialist class of just eight pupils with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D),.
Working alongside experienced teaching assistants, you will plan and deliver engaging, tailored lessons that support pupils' individual learning needs while promoting confidence, independence, and academic progress.
The Role:
* Full-time, September 2026 (Term time only)
* Small specialist KS2 ASD class (8 pupils)
* Supported by experienced teaching assistants
The Ideal Candidate Will Have:
* Qualified Teacher Status (QTS)
* Strong classroom management and communication skills
* A patient, flexible, and nurturing approach to teaching
ECTs are welcome to apply!
This is a great opportunity for an Early Career Teacher looking to develop their experience within a supportive SEND environment, with guidance and support available.
What the School Offers:
* A welcoming and supportive leadership team
* Excellent classroom resources and facilities
* Ongoing training and professional development opportunities
* Consistent support from dedicated teaching assistants
* A positive and collaborative working environment
